This is
the first census that lists the folks by name, age, and the state they were
born in. Not always that easy to identify them, but now we know the characters.
This listing will be by county. Once again, if possible, I will give the number
that Eben Putnam assigned. This census was pretty much put together by Rand
Putnam of California, who sorted it out and assigned the numbers where
possible. Many thanks, Rand.
